| Cluster of Coprinopsis atramentaria mushrooms, characterized by their brown, smooth, bell-shaped caps with slight wrinkling. The caps appear moist and are slightly overlapping, growing closely together on grassy terrain. Known as the inky cap, this species is notable for auto-digesting into a black liquid when mature. Often found in nutrient-rich soil, these fungi play an important role in decomposing organic matter. The surrounding greenery provides contrast, highlighting the natural habitat. |
